Skip to content

Commit 5ca088d

Browse files
committed
Use new window width APIs
1 parent 0f6a241 commit 5ca088d

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

compose/snippets/src/main/java/com/example/compose/snippets/adaptivelayouts/SampleNavigationSuiteScaffold.kt

+2-2
Original file line numberDiff line numberDiff line change
@@ -39,7 +39,7 @@ import androidx.compose.runtime.setValue
3939
import androidx.compose.ui.graphics.Color
4040
import androidx.compose.ui.graphics.vector.ImageVector
4141
import androidx.compose.ui.res.stringResource
42-
import androidx.window.core.layout.WindowWidthSizeClass
42+
import androidx.window.core.layout.WindowSizeClass.Companion.WIDTH_DP_EXPANDED_LOWER_BOUND
4343
import com.example.compose.snippets.R
4444

4545
// [START android_compose_adaptivelayouts_sample_navigation_suite_scaffold_destinations]
@@ -159,7 +159,7 @@ fun SampleNavigationSuiteScaffoldCustomType() {
159159
// [START android_compose_adaptivelayouts_sample_navigation_suite_scaffold_layout_type]
160160
val adaptiveInfo = currentWindowAdaptiveInfo()
161161
val customNavSuiteType = with(adaptiveInfo) {
162-
if (windowSizeClass.windowWidthSizeClass == WindowWidthSizeClass.EXPANDED) {
162+
if (windowSizeClass.isWidthAtLeastBreakpoint(WIDTH_DP_EXPANDED_LOWER_BOUND)) {
163163
NavigationSuiteType.NavigationDrawer
164164
} else {
165165
NavigationSuiteScaffoldDefaults.calculateFromAdaptiveInfo(adaptiveInfo)

0 commit comments

Comments
 (0)